What do I do if I dropped my Samsung Galaxy S10 in water
If your device has been waterlogged, it is important to remove the moisture or impurities and then to air dry the device in a well-ventilated area or in the shade with cool air. Air drying is the best option to avoid damaging your device. However, if you must use a hair dryer or hot air to rapidly dry your device, please note that this may damage your device.
If your Galaxy device gets wet, it’s important to take it out of its case and remove any other accessories or plug-ins as soon as possible. Use a soft towel to dry off and absorb any standing water on your Galaxy’s exterior.
How do you bypass moisture detected on S10e?
If you see a moisture error message, it means that your device has detected moisture in the USB port. To fix this, unplug your device from the charger and wipe the port with a dry cloth. You can also gently shake your device (5-10 times) with the port facing downwards to release any excess moisture.

Can S10 get water damage
If your Samsung Galaxy S10 Plus has water damage, you may need to take it to a repair shop to get it fixed. The Liquid Damage Indicator (LDI) can help you determine if your device has water damage.
The easiest way to check for water damage on your Samsung Galaxy S10 is to check the Liquid Damage Indicator (LDI). The LDI is a sticker placed inside of your Samsung Galaxy S10 SIM card holder that changes color and pattern when exposed to water. If you see any color change or pattern change on the LDI, that means your phone has water damage.

Can I use my Samsung S10 underwater?
If you’re looking for a durable and reliable smartphone, the Samsung Galaxy S10e / S10 / S10+ is a great option. It’s rated IP68, meaning it’s both dust and water resistant. The dust rating is 6 (highest level of protection), and the water resistance rating is 8 (water-resistant up to 5 feet for up to 30 minutes). So you can rest assured knowing your phone can withstand some tough conditions.
If your Samsung phone displays a water drop icon while charging, it means that the moisture detected in the USB port has exceeded the set point. In such cases, the very first thing you should do is unplug your phone from the charger and avoid charging it until it’s completely dry. This is to prevent any damage to your phone from the moisture.
